It is crucial to differentiate Creutzfeldt–Jakob disease (CJD) from other potentially treatable diseases. The diagnosis of CJD is supported by periodic sharp wave complexes on electroencephalography (EEG), a neuronal injury marker in cerebrospinal fluid, and cortical and subcortical hyperintensities on diffusionweighted imaging (DWI). However, these features are not specific for CJD. We report a patient with limbic encephalitis associated with anti-voltage-gated potassium channel complex antibodies (anti-VGKCC-ab) who presented similar clinical and DWI findings to those characteristic of CJD. The patient was a 58-year-old man who gradually developed memory impairment. Two consecutive brain magnetic resonance imaging scans (2 and 5 months after onset) carried out at a local clinic detected a transient hyperintense lesion in the left mesial temporal lobe on fluid-attenuated inversion recovery imaging, with subsequent mesial temporal lobe atrophy. No DWI abnormality was observed. Subsequently, his memory impairment was aggravated, and hallucinations and a depressive state occurred. His mental symptoms deteriorated relentlessly without remission. Then, 9 months after symptom onset, he was admitted to our clinic for further evaluation (Kyushu university hospital, Fukuoka, Japan).On his first visit, the neurological examination was normal, except for severe retrograde and anterograde amnesia, hallucinations, and a depressive state. Faciobrachial dystonic seizure was not observed. The Wechsler Adult Intelligence Scale III was within the normal limits. The Wechsler Memory Scale-Revised was abnormal in logical, visual and delayed memory, with scores of 26, 46 and 32, respectively. Serum analysis showed hyponatremia (132 mEq/L). Tumor markers and antibodies for collagen diseases were all negative.
